Chaos Legion was published by Capcom[5]. It was produced by Yoshinori Ono[8].
Publication
Chaos Legion was published on March 6, 2003[17]. Genres include action-adventure game[6] and hack and slash[7]. It was distributed by DVD-ROM[13].
